UCSB prof probed after comparing Israel to Nazis
SANTA BARBARA, Calif. — The University of California, Santa Barbara, is investigating allegations of improper conduct and anti-Semitism against a Jewish professor who compared Israel’s treatment of Palestinians to the Holocaust.
Sociology professor William I. Robinson sent an e-mail to 80 of his students in January that contained photos of Jews killed by the Nazis and similar photos of Palestinians killed in the recent Israeli offensive in the Gaza Strip. The e-mail used the terms concentration camp and genocide when referring to Gaza.
Two Jewish students quit the class and filed complaints. Jewish groups also have complained.
Robinson argues that he was within his rights of academic freedom to challenge students with controversial topics.
